I ran a chunk of this adventure with a group of friends (although we used my homemade game system, Be You Bold) and had a great time. I expanded a few details for the village, incorporating the parts presented, and we had a great time. They encountered the Bole Ox on the road and then explored the mill. The Birch Moths and Dull Axe added a lot. Anyway, the charts to roll on worked well, created some great feeling of the supernatural, and we had a great time. Thanks.

Sure. I added an Inn called the Broken Shield so the party would have someplace to easily stay, aside from trying to camp or knock on someone's door. I decided the village was a place that had prospered in the past but was now on hard times, this fit with the theme of the Mill for me, so there were some vacated homes and some overgrown farm land, stuff like that. I love the image of orchards that have not been tended to, tall grass and lots of fruit on the ground, unpruned, that kind of thing. I definitely used the villagers you provided in the adventure as part of all that.
